Lecturers
293 registered lecturers | Page 24 of 30Register your act
-
Lecturer ID3125
United States of America
-
Lecturer ID3046
United States of America
-
Lecturer ID2988
United States of America
-
Lecturer ID2658
United States of America
-
Lecturer ID2657
Canada
-
Lecturer ID2609
United States of America
-
Lecturer ID2549
United States of America
-
Lecturer ID2544
South Africa
-
Lecturer ID2524
Australia
-
Lecturer ID2450
United States of America